Housing Stock in Lidzbarski County 2026

Lidzbarski county ranks 346 of 380 Polish counties. Dwelling stock grew by 205 units +1.35% between 2019-2024, now at 15,339.

Among 41 growing counties, in bottom 20% for housing growth rate. Within Warmian-Masurian province, ranks 16 of 21 counties.

Based on 31 years of official GUS housing market statistics for Lidzbarski county and its 5 municipalities within Warmian-Masurian province.
